如何学好vue

如何学好vue

要学好Vue,需要关注以下几个关键点:1、基础知识的扎实掌握,2、实践项目的积累,3、社区资源的利用,4、理解Vue生态系统,5、持续学习与更新。首先,Vue的基础知识是学习的起点,涵盖其核心概念、组件、指令等内容;其次,通过实际项目的开发可以巩固和应用所学知识;第三,充分利用社区资源,包括文档、论坛、教程等;第四,深入理解Vue的生态系统,包括Vue Router、Vuex等;最后,保持对新版本和新特性的关注,持续学习和更新知识。

一、基础知识的扎实掌握

  1. 核心概念

    • Vue的核心概念包括实例、模板语法、响应式数据绑定、计算属性和侦听器等。
    • 了解这些基本概念是学习Vue的第一步,建议通过官方文档和基础教程进行学习。
  2. 组件

    • 组件是Vue的核心构建块,掌握组件的定义、传参、生命周期等是非常重要的。
    • 学习如何在组件之间进行通信以及如何组织和管理组件。
  3. 指令

    • Vue提供了一些内置指令,如v-bind、v-model、v-for等,熟悉这些指令的使用场景和方法是必要的。

二、实践项目的积累

  1. 从小项目开始

    • 通过构建一些小型项目(如待办事项应用、记事本等)来练习和应用基础知识。
    • 小项目有助于快速上手并理解Vue的工作原理。
  2. 逐步增加复杂度

    • 在掌握基础之后,可以尝试构建更复杂的项目(如电商网站、博客系统等)。
    • 这些项目能够帮助你理解如何处理复杂的状态管理、路由和组件通信。
  3. 代码复盘和优化

    • 定期对自己的项目代码进行复盘,寻找可以优化的地方。
    • 优化代码不仅可以提高性能,还能提升代码的可读性和维护性。

三、社区资源的利用

  1. 官方文档

    • Vue的官方文档是学习的最佳资源,内容详尽且覆盖了所有核心概念和高级特性。
  2. 在线教程和课程

    • 利用一些优质的在线教程和课程(如Udemy、Coursera等)可以系统性地学习Vue。
  3. 论坛和社区

    • 参与Vue相关的论坛和社区(如Stack Overflow、GitHub、Reddit等),可以获取他人的经验和建议,解决学习过程中遇到的问题。
  4. 开源项目

    • 通过参与和浏览开源项目的代码,可以学习到实际开发中的最佳实践和技巧。

四、理解Vue生态系统

  1. Vue Router

    • Vue Router是Vue.js的官方路由管理器,掌握其基本用法和高级特性(如动态路由、路由守卫等)是构建单页应用的关键。
  2. Vuex

    • Vuex是Vue.js的状态管理模式,了解其核心概念(如State、Getter、Mutation、Action)和使用场景可以帮助你管理应用状态。
  3. Vue CLI

    • Vue CLI是一个标准化的Vue项目脚手架工具,熟悉如何使用Vue CLI来创建和管理项目,可以大大提高开发效率。
  4. 第三方库和插件

    • 掌握一些常用的第三方库和插件(如Vuetify、Element等),可以丰富你的项目功能和提升开发体验。

五、持续学习与更新

  1. 关注官方更新

    • 经常查看Vue的官方博客和更新日志,了解新版本的特性和改进。
    • 新版本通常会带来性能优化和新功能,保持更新可以让你的项目保持竞争力。
  2. 参加技术会议和讲座

    • 参加一些与Vue相关的技术会议和讲座(如VueConf),可以获取最新的行业动态和技术趋势。
  3. 阅读技术博客和书籍

    • 阅读一些高质量的技术博客和书籍(如《Vue.js权威指南》),可以深入理解Vue的设计理念和高级用法。
  4. 练习和分享

    • 持续练习所学知识,通过撰写博客或在社区中分享自己的经验和心得,可以加深对知识的理解和记忆。

总结

学好Vue需要扎实的基础知识、丰富的实践经验、充分利用社区资源、深入理解Vue生态系统以及持续的学习和更新。通过系统化的学习和不断的实践,可以逐步掌握Vue的各项技能,提升自己的开发水平。建议从小项目开始,逐步增加复杂度,并积极参与社区交流,不断优化和完善自己的知识体系。

相关问答FAQs:

1. 为什么选择学习Vue?

Vue是一种流行的JavaScript框架,用于构建用户界面。它具有简单易学、灵活和高效的特点,被广泛应用于前端开发中。选择学习Vue的原因有以下几点:

  • 易学性:Vue的语法简单直观,相较于其他框架,上手较快。即使你是初学者,也能迅速掌握基本概念和使用方法。

  • 灵活性:Vue提供了丰富的功能和组件,可以根据项目需求自由选择使用。它支持单文件组件开发,使代码可维护性更高。

  • 高效性:Vue采用了虚拟DOM技术,能够高效地更新和渲染页面。它还提供了响应式数据绑定和组件化开发,使开发过程更加高效和便捷。

2. 如何开始学习Vue?

  • 基础知识学习:首先,你需要了解HTML、CSS和JavaScript的基础知识。这些是前端开发的基石,对于学习Vue来说至关重要。

  • 官方文档:Vue提供了详细的官方文档,包含了所有的核心概念和API,是学习Vue的最佳资源。你可以按照文档的步骤,逐渐学习和实践Vue的各个方面。

  • 实践项目:理论知识只是学习的一部分,实践项目才能真正巩固和提升你的技能。你可以尝试使用Vue构建一些简单的应用程序,如待办事项列表或博客应用,以此来熟悉Vue的用法。

  • 参考资料:除了官方文档外,还有许多优秀的教程、视频和书籍可供参考。你可以根据自己的学习风格选择适合自己的学习资料,加深对Vue的理解。

3. 如何提高Vue的学习效果?

  • 实际项目经验:除了学习理论知识,实际项目经验是提高Vue技能的关键。尝试参与开源项目或与其他开发者合作,这样你可以学习到更多实际应用的技巧和经验。

  • 阅读源码:Vue是一个开源项目,你可以阅读它的源码来深入理解其内部工作原理。这样可以帮助你更好地理解Vue的设计思想和实现方式。

  • 参与社区:Vue拥有活跃的社区,你可以加入Vue的官方论坛或社交媒体群组,与其他开发者交流和分享经验。这样可以扩展你的人际网络,获得更多学习和成长的机会。

  • 持续学习:前端技术在不断发展,新的特性和工具层出不穷。要保持与时俱进,你需要不断学习和掌握新的知识。定期阅读技术博客、参加技术会议和培训,都是提高Vue技能的好方法。

学习Vue需要时间和耐心,但只要你保持学习的热情和持续努力,你一定能够掌握这个强大的JavaScript框架,并在前端开发中取得成功。

文章标题:如何学好vue,发布者:飞飞,转载请注明出处:https://worktile.com/kb/p/3603228

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
飞飞的头像飞飞

发表回复

登录后才能评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部